Davante Adams or George Pickens: Who Should You Start?
2026 Week 2 · deterministic head-to-head · Verdicts based on PPR scoring.
Pickens' heavier deployment wins a close call over Adams' better scoring setup
Pickens gets the nod because his heavier deployment gives him a sturdier weekly floor than Adams' lower-snap WR2 role. Adams still has the better scoring environment and a clear red-zone path, while his quiet opener looks more like a rebound opportunity than a vanished role (NBC Sports 2026-09-10). Pickens' drops are the real concern, but planned work from the slot and in motion could broaden his access to targets (NFL.com 2026-09-14; Yahoo Sports/Sporting News 2026-09-10). Both are starts; Pickens is the stronger play, though the margin is narrower than the ranking gap suggests.
What flips it: A confirmed reduction in Pickens' route or alignment workload before kickoff.

The call
- Role is intact: 22% target share as the WR-2 in a Rams offense with a 28.5 implied team total, the kind of volume-plus-scoring-chance combo you start at WR2/flex.
- Matchup is neutral, not scary — Giants sit 16 of 32 in DvP composite, so nothing about the defense caps his ceiling.
- Week 1 was ugly (3 of 6 for 26 yards, long of 13) and the 54% snap share is the real concern; if that number doesn't climb he's a volume-dependent WR3.
- Rams favored by 8.5 raises late-game run-script risk, but a 28.5 implied total means plenty of red-zone looks before the clock-killing starts.
